    Dobson Loop Track – A taste of the Tararuas

    A truly great day circuit with beautiful bush, swimming holes, and a bit of good ol’ fashioned puff! The track begins confidently, heading past the Kiwi Ranch Camp before zig-zagging uphill. You’ll reach the junction with the track to Marchant Ridge and Alpha Hut within 20-30 minutes (this is the way you’ll return). The gentle climb to Puffer Saddle is smooth, easy, and mostly shady—welcome on a hot summer’s day. Occasionally you’ll be treated to views over the Kaitoke and Pakuratahi Basin.
